This book briefly develops the issues of Educational Science primarily from a systematic perspective in six chapters.
First, the cognitive object and the basic terminology of Education are defined, and the structural features and basic prerequisites of education and learning (educational process) are specified.
Next, the purposes of education, the means used to achieve them, and the behavior of parents, educators, and adults in general towards children and adolescents are examined.
The following thematic unit highlights the social context within which the educational process is situated and specifically addresses the institutions (organizations and establishments) where it takes place.
The final chapter of the book discusses research methods and the methodological problems of Educational Science.
